Introduction


"Computer Hardware Fundamentals: Inside the Machine" is an engaging guide that takes readers on a journey through the intricate world of computer hardware. This book offers a comprehensive overview of the various components that make up a computer system, explaining their functions and how they work together to create a powerful computing machine.

The book begins with an introduction to the basic anatomy of a computer, covering the central processing unit (CPU), memory, storage devices, input/output devices, and the motherboard. It explains the role of each component and how they interact to perform various tasks.

Next, the focus shifts to the internals of the CPU, exploring its architecture and design. The book delves into the complexities of instruction sets, microarchitecture, and caching mechanisms, giving readers a deep understanding of how the CPU executes programs and manages data.

Memory and storage are also covered in detail, with explanations of different types of memory (RAM, ROM, cache memory) and storage devices (hard drives, solid-state drives). The book discusses the trade-offs between speed and capacity, as well as the latest advancements in storage technology.

In addition to the core components, the book also covers peripherals and expansion cards, such as graphics cards, sound cards, and network interfaces. It explains how these devices enhance the functionality of a computer system and improve the user experience.

Throughout the book, the author uses clear language and illustrative diagrams to make complex concepts easy to understand. It also includes practical tips and advice on hardware selection, upgrades, and maintenance, helping readers make informed decisions when building or upgrading their own computer systems.

"Computer Hardware Fundamentals: Inside the Machine" is an essential resource for anyone interested in understanding the inner workings of a computer. It provides a solid foundation that will enable readers to appreciate the complexity and elegance of modern computer systems.
